What country wide acknowledged means in practice
Nationally acknowledged emergency treatment courses in Australia sit within the employment education and learning structure and are supplied by Registered Training Organisations, or RTOs, that are managed by ASQA. When you complete a device of competency, your Statement of Attainment is portable across states and approved by employers and industry bodies. For people trying to find an erina first aid course, check that the training course code appears on your reservation verification and the RTO number is visible. If you see HLTAID009, HLTAID011, or HLTAID012, you are taking a look at the existing across the country recommended systems under training package HLT.
The RTO responsibility is not just paperwork. It determines the ratio of technique to theory, the types of analyses, fitness instructor qualifications, and how responses obtains videotaped. It additionally supports material to the latest Australian Resuscitation Council guidelines, which are evaluated and upgraded. The core programs available in Erina
Most students in Erina will be selecting in between three main options, each lined up to a device of competency. Carriers might package these with mixed or reveal formats, but the device code remains the vital reference.
- HLTAID009 Offer cardiopulmonary resuscitation. This is the go to cpr course erina citizens take when they need to revitalize mouth-to-mouth resuscitation only. It covers adult, child, and infant m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, safe use of an AED, and responding to choking. Expect around 2 to 3 hours one-on-one, plus any type of pre knowing if your instructor requires it. HLTAID011 Give First Aid. Typically called the full emergency treatment, this constructs mouth-to-mouth resuscitation into a more comprehensive response. It covers bleeding control, shock, fractures, strains, burns, asthma, anaphylaxis, seizures, diabetic issues emergency situations, and standard injury care. In Erina, first aid training typically runs as an one day course with pre course reading or e discovering. Time in the room is normally 5 to 6 hours. HLTAID012 Offer First Aid in an education and learning and care setting. This is the childcare first aid course erina early childhood team and out of school hours educators normally require. It includes HLTAID009 level CPR and an anaphylaxis and bronchial asthma monitoring focus that matches education and learning sector requirements. Timetables look similar to HLTAID011, although some providers add added technique time on Epipen strategy, asthma spacers, and kid certain scenarios.
A fourth unit, HLTAID010 Give fundamental emergency life assistance, appears at times, but a lot of work environments now choose HLTAID011 due to the fact that it is a lot more comprehensive at virtually the exact same financial investment of time. What the day actually looks like
People typically anticipate a lecture. A strong first aid training in Erina does the contrary. The fitness instructor lays out manikins, AED fitness instructors, plasters, triangular slings, EpiPen fitness instructors, spacer devices, and improvisated products like towels and canteen. After quick concept, you cycle through stations. The repetition is calculated. Mouth-to-mouth resuscitation is a motor skill, and your muscular tissues learn the rhythm best with realistic, timed compressions.
Expect to find out and practise these core relocations:
- Safe strategy utilizing DRSABCD, with fast risk checks and clear phone calls for aid. This simple framework stops rescuer injuries and quicken decision making. High high quality mouth-to-mouth resuscitation with 30 to 2 compressions to breaths, 100 to 120 compressions per min, compressing one third the breast depth. You will practise on grown-up, youngster, and infant manikins and swap duties as compressor, air passage supervisor, and timekeeper. Fitness instructors will certainly ask you to continue compressions for 2 mins straight so you experience the tiredness and find out to handle it. AED usage with very little disruptions. You will certainly deal with trainer pads, comply with motivates, and practise cleaning everybody from the individual before supplying a shock. Choking responses throughout age, including back blows, upper body drives, and when to switch to CPR. Bleeding control with straight stress, wound packing where proper, elevation, and the facts of limited materials. Tourniquet use is reviewed where relevant. Fracture management, sprains, and slings, including improvisated splinting. In a normal erina emergency treatment training session, tradies get to demonstrate just how to secure with what remains in the ute. Burns first aid using great running water for 20 minutes, plus tips on preventing ice and oily natural remedy that make complex care. Asthma and anaphylaxis administration utilizing spacers and vehicle injectors, with practice on grown-up and younger gadgets. Assessment, certification, and for how long everything lasts
Nationally acknowledged ways you will be assessed against the device requirements. That normally entails an understanding element and functional demonstration of abilities and circumstances. Trainers observe you and record proof. If you have actually already done the pre training course analysis or e finding out, the theory area will feel familiar and move swiftly. Do not let the documentation stress you. Experienced fitness instructors trainer, ask making clear questions, and set up scenarios so you can show what you know.
On effective conclusion you obtain a Declaration of Accomplishment. Most RTOs provide digital certificates within 24 hours, often the same day, provided your USI, or Distinct Pupil Identifier, is confirmed. You need a USI to get any type of nationally acknowledged veterinarian certificate in Australia. If you do not have one, established it up online before course. It takes a couple of mins with an ID document.
As for how much time the certificate stands, sector standards and ARC advice shape refresher course assumptions. CPR currency is annual. Several workplaces on the Central Shore ask for HLTAID009 to be rejuvenated every year, especially in healthcare, aged care, education and learning, health and fitness, and safety. Emergency treatment material under HLTAID011 and HLTAID012 generally revitalizes every 3 years. Inspect your employer policy. If your function subjects you to higher threat, earlier refresher courses maintain your hands and head sharp.

Workplace conformity in Erina and the Central Coast
Under the onsite first aid training NSW Job Health and Safety Guideline, a person conducting a business or endeavor should make sure emergency treatment tools and centers are suitable and that an ample number of workers are educated. Appropriate relies on danger. A workplace in Erina Fair with reduced dangers may require 1 or 2 skilled first aiders per floor, clear signage, stocked sets, and a defibrillator made easy to reach. A stockroom near the Pacific Highway handling shipments, forklifts, and warm might require extra insurance coverage, even more thorough sets, and drills.
If you manage a site in Erina, start with a first aid threat analysis. Consider risks, team numbers, changes, geographical spread, and how long emergency services might require to get here. Childcare, colleges, and out of college hours care
Education and care settings rest under specific guidelines. Services require personnel on duty with authorized bronchial asthma and anaphylaxis training and emergency treatment proficiency lined up to HLTAID012. For Erina day care centers, long daycare, and OSHC, that usually means organizing a childcare first aid course erina before term begins, then maintaining a rolling refresher schedule so insurance coverage does not lapse throughout leave or staff turn over. Excellent providers customize web content to practical youngster and baby situations and enable staff to practice with actual gadgets kept site, so muscle mass memory builds around the tools they will reach for.

What your certificate actually covers
An emergency treatment certificate erina straightened with HLTAID011 or HLTAID012 shows that, on assessment day, you showed the understanding and skills required by that unit. It does not make you a paramedic or a nurse. It does not authorise invasive treatments. It does offer you a structure to act within your duty, to acknowledge red flags, and to start life conserving actions. In almost every genuine occasion I have actually seen, the distinction maker was not heroic technique. It was early recognition, calm directions, and premium quality fundamental care supplied without delay.

A note on kit maintenance and AEDs around Erina
Training is only half the formula. A well stocked kit and a working AED close at hand cut minutes off your action. Designate obligation for monthly checks. Make sure dressings are within expiration and handwear covers are undamaged. For AEDs, track battery and pad dates and recognize just how to open the closet without a code if it is concerned yet public. Lots of shopping center and clubs around Erina display AEDs near entrances. During training, ask your company to chat with just how to retrieve one quickly and how to send out a jogger while you start compressions.
